Ошибки Hadoop 2.6 start-dfs.sh на Centos 6.7 [закрыто]

Я использую этот учебник для установки Hadoop 2.6 на Centos 6.7 с Java 1.8.0_72, и все идет хорошо до выполнения start-dfs.sh из Hadoop-home / sbin / srart-dfs.sh. Ниже приведен результат:

[hadoop@10 sbin]$  start-dfs.sh
16/02/26 21:47:40 W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able
Starting namenodes on [localhost]
localhost: /etc/bashrc: line 65: id: command not found
localhost: /etc/bashrc: line 65: id: command not found
localhost: /usr/bin/env: bash: No such file or directory
localhost: /etc/bashrc: line 65: id: command not found
localhost: /etc/bashrc: line 65: id: command not found
localhost: /usr/bin/env: bash: No such file or directory
Starting secondary namenodes [0.0.0.0]
0.0.0.0: /etc/bashrc: line 65: id: command not found
0.0.0.0: /etc/bashrc: line 65: id: command not found
0.0.0.0: /usr/bin/env: bash: No such file or directory
16/02/26 21:47:46 W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able

Кажется, что-то не так с / etv / bashrc @, строка 65. Но я проверил и ничего не изменил.

Я запускаю финальную версию CentOS 6.7 с помощью диспетчера параллельных виртуальных машин моего Mac, который является 64-разрядной машиной.

Заранее спасибо

1
задан 27 February 2016 в 13:45

2 ответа

Это не решение Вашей проблемы, но это укажет на что-то, что может действительно выручить Вас. По крайней мере, это работало в моем случае без любых проблем. Несколько месяцев назад я записал блог об установке единственного узла hadoop кластер в Ubuntu. Можно обратиться к этому здесь

, я использовал эти две ссылки для Hadoop1 (MRv1) link1 link2

И этот для Hadoop2 (MRv2)

link3

Оба времена, которые я имею успешный с точки зрения выполнения их на моей Ubuntu destkop машины. Можно отослать эти ссылки с этой целью.

1
ответ дан 7 December 2019 в 13:48

Спасибо Все для подсказок. Я выяснил, что проблема появляется, когда я запускаю

ssh localhost

затем, я понял, что ПУТЬ в/etc/environment повреждается. Инструкция, данная учебным руководством, не работает на меня без, исправляют. Так, я добавил весь ниже необходимого пути прежде, чем обеспечить путь jdk. Проблема решила это легкое, но заняла 2 дня для меня для выяснения.

export PATH=/usr/bin:/bin:/usr/sbin:/sbin:/usr/local/bin:/usr/X11/bin:/opt/jdk1.8.0_73/bin:/opt/jdk1.8.0_73/jre/bin

я надеюсь, что другие также извлекают пользу из этого Q& A.

Спасибо

1
ответ дан 7 December 2019 в 13:48

Другие вопросы по тегам:

Похожие вопросы: